The Benefits of Financial Counseling

Each new year, we set personal goals and ask ourselves questions about how to achieve those goals; Do I need a gym membership? Do I need to pursue a new career? And the question that Family First is best poised to help you answer: Do I need a financial counselor?

If you’re looking for inspiration with organizing your finances in 2022, you might be feeling less than inspired by the oft-repeated advice to make coffee at home rather than spend $6 at your favorite coffee shop.

While the theory behind this advice is sound, it is often ignored because it puts you in a position where you may feel like you must give up all the things you enjoy in order to save money – and this simply isn’t realistic! You could possibly glean some useful tips from the plethora of financial advice articles typically available in the New Year, but there is certainly no “one-size-fits-all” approach.

This is where meeting with an expert can be incredibly beneficial; our certified financial counselors recognize that creating a financial plan that works for your unique financial situation takes time and careful consideration.

Here are 3 reasons why you should consider meeting with a financial counselor in 2022:

Assess Your Saving & Spending Habits

It can be helpful to have a fresh set of eyes take a deeper look at your saving and spending habits. Financial Counselors can provide creative solutions to help you save money in areas you may not have considered and help you identify areas that could use improvement – they can even provide free tools and techniques to help you control your spending!

Identify Financial Goals

Together, you can work towards your short, medium, and long-term goals and create a sustainable plan that is designed to work for you specifically. A short-term financial goal might include saving for your next vacation or starting an emergency fund, whereas long-term financial goals could include buying a house or saving up for your retirement. Whatever your goals are, a financial counselor can help you build a financial plan to succeed.

Maintain Accountability

Did you know people who sign up for a gym membership in the New Year and utilize the services of a personal trainer are 30% more likely to reach their fitness goals than those who go at it alone? Having someone in your corner who not only keeps you on track and accountable, but also helps you celebrate your success, is an invaluable asset towards accomplishing your goals.
